Both of my 2.4.23 boxes reports excessive size-64 objects

1) on my 512MB box, it's 3176370 3176442 64 53838 53838 1
2) on my 128MB box, it's 1223329 1223365 64 20735 20735 1

Is this really normal? Both boxes have been up for 2 days, but the 128MB
box is starting to show signs of getting slower and slower the more the
size-64 cache increases.
